    Water Chilling

    Water glass is used as coagulant/flocculant agent in waste water treatment plants. Waterglass binds to colloidal molecules, creating larger aggregates that sink to the bottom of the water column. The microscopic negatively charged particles suspended in water interact with sodium silicate. Their...
